Jaunting Car Tour to Ross Castle from Killarney
Travel back in time as you take a traditional Jaunting Car Ride through the Killarney National Park and on to Ross Castle situated on the banks of the spectacular Killarney Lakes. Take in the sights of some of Killarney’s most popular scenic hotspots like the iconic high spire of St. Mary’s Cathedral and the Deenagh Lodge and River as your private carriage takes a ramble through the magnificent landscape of the Killarney National Park. Be transported back to 15th century Ireland with stories of the legendary stronghold of the O’Donoghue Chieftains and the ancient Castle’s tragic fall to the Cromwellian Army on their conquest of Ireland, the legend of the Lake and much more. Learn more about the nature of the Park as well as its famous wildlife inhabitants including the Irish Red Deer. 1 hour Lake Cruise on Killarney's Largest Lake
Embark on a picturesque voyage aboard the M.V Pride of the Lakes, as it weaves through the tranquil waters of Killarney's Lough Leane. Departing from the historic Ross Castle of the 15th century, this cozy, heated vessel presents an unparalleled way to appreciate the region's serene landscape. Marvel at the pristine chain of islands set against the dramatic backdrop of the McGillycuddy Reeks, and keep an eye out for the majestic white-tailed eagles and elegant sika deer during your journey, complete with enlightening live commentary.
Private Tour of Ring of Kerry & Valentia Island
Embark on a breathtaking journey through the scenic Ring of Kerry, starting from your accommodation in Killarney, Killorglin, or Cahersiveen. Discover the panoramic vistas of Sneem, the historical allure of Valentia Island where the pioneering Transatlantic Cable connected Europe with the U.S.A. in 1866, with a piece of the cable present in your minivan for hands-on history. Your five to seven-hour excursion includes a stop at the Skellig Experience to watch an enlightening video about Skellig Michael, entrance fee courtesy of the operator. Along the way, marvel at Ireland's natural beauty with short walks, observe local lifestyles, and consider an optional visit to a charming pub for a taste of seafood. The journey showcases Ireland’s tallest peaks in the Macgillycuddy's Reeks, the legacy of Daniel O'Connell, and concludes with a serene stroll to Torc Waterfall in the National Park.
